Which transformer is used for 110v to 220v?
A Step Up transformer is needed when you want to use a 220-volt foreign appliance in the USA with 110v. A Step-Down transformer is needed when you want to use a 110V appliance in a 220V Country.
What is step down transformer 220v to 110v?
220v to 110v Step-Down converter or transformer reduces the incoming 220v or 240 Volt electricity found in most parts of the world to 110 Volt USA power. These voltage transformers enable the use of 110v USA electrical products in foreign countries where the voltage ranges from 220 Volt.

Does a step down transformer increase current?
A step-up transformer increases voltage and decreases current, whereas a step-down transformer decreases voltage and increases current.

Do step down transformers work?
How Does the Transformer Work? The concept of a step-down transformer is actually quite simple. The transfer has more turns of wire on the primary coil as compared to the turns on the secondary coil. This reduces the induced voltage running through the secondary coil, which ultimately reduces the output voltage.
